Ergonomica is a dynamic tiling window manager designed for Linux operating systems. It automatically tiles open application windows to optimize screen usage without manual configuration.Unlike traditional window managers that are mouse-oriented, Ergonomica utilizes keyboard shortcuts so that users can efficiently manage windows and workspaces.
